About Certified Reports Inc
Certified Reports, Inc. has been providing critical intelligence at the theatre level since 1956. Since its inception, CRI has been continually developing new and innovative methods of managing and reporting data to its clients. What Is the Cost of Living Near Albany?

Understanding the cost of living near Albany is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Certified Reports Inc.
Albany's Cost of Living Index is approximately 97.3 (2.7% less expensive than US average; 22.2% less than NY average). State capital, housing near US average. CDTA bus. When planning your budget based on a salary from Certified Reports Inc,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,200 - $1,700+ A significant portion of Certified Reports Inc sal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$160 - $270 (Heating significant)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$65 (CDTA mon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$410 - $600 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$360 - $680+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$390 - $720+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,585 - $3,975+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
